Feb. 28, 2003

Humacao, Puerto Rico – The South Carolina women’s golf team stands in a tie for sixth place after the second round of the Lady Puerto Rico Classic in Humacao, Puerto Rico. The Lady Gamecocks fired a 302 in Friday afternoon’s second round and are tied with Kent State and Wake Forest. Fifth ranked Duke lead by 13 strokes after firing a 288 Friday afternoon.

Senior All-American Kristy McPherson is tied for 12th place heading into Saturday’s final round. McPherson fired her second straight two-over par 74 and is seven shots off the lead. She is shooting four-over par for the tournament.

Junior Marci Robinson continues her run, firing a four-over par 76 and has a five-over par 149 for the tournament. Robinson is tied for 16th place. The remaining scores for the Lady Gamecocks are senior Kacy Thompson (75, 151, T28) junior Adrienne Gautreaux (77,157, T54) and sophomore Tiffany Catafygiotu (80, 162, T69).

Duke continues to lead the field firing a 288 Friday afternoon for a total score of 579. Florida jumped into second place also firing a 288, and has a total score of 592. Auburn is in third place with a total score 598, followed by Texas with a 602, and Georgia rounds out the top five with a 603.

V. Nirapathpongporn leads the individual field by two strokes heading into the final round after firing a one-under par 71 for a total score of three-under par 141. Aimee Cho of Florida is in second place after recording a two-under par 70 for a total score of one-under par 143. Kristina Engstrom of Duke fired the lowest round of the day, a three-under par 69, and has a total score of even-par 144. Suzie Fisher of Tulsa and Lisa Ferrero of Texas are tied for fourth place, each with a total score of one-over par 145.
